Effective cash flow monitoring strategies matter
Small businesses are most at risk from cash flow management problems. It is essential to maintain or improve your cash flow to keep things running while you wait for your accounts receivables to receive and process payments from customers.
Cash management, at its core, is about optimizing your company’s working capital by:
- Reduce your excess cash
- Balance cash outflows and inflows precisely and thoroughly.
- Ensure that all cash is used with an eye towards maximum return on investment (ROI) and value creation.
- You must have enough working capital to meet the company’s financial obligations. There should also be enough to pay for unexpected expenses or take advantage of investment opportunities. This requires balance.
- Companies must identify, track, and mitigate risks when determining the optimal cash balance.
- They should also chart the expected ROI for each option, as well as the opportunity cost. To capture discounts, vendors should pay invoices earlier than usual and make payments when they are due.
